Job Description

RoleSummary

Senior cyber security risk professional responsiblefor leading risk assessments, providing strategic risk guidance, andinfluencing business decisions through clear communication of cyber securityrisks and opportunities.

KeyAccountabilities

- Lead cyber security riskassessments across projects, products, and technology initiatives.
- Collaborate with project teamsto identify, assess, and address security gaps and control deficiencies.
- Communicate complex technicalrisks in clear business terms, including to executive stakeholders through riskdecision-making processes.
- Make informed risk-baseddecisions and manage stakeholder expectations effectively.
- Lead the uplift of teamprocesses, documentation, and engagement models.

AdditionalResponsibilities

- Collaborate with businessstakeholders, engineers, delivery teams, product vendors, partners, and cyberassurance teams to understand and communicate cyber risk.




- Define and maintain reusableassets including standardised findings, templates, and process improvements.
- Contribute to the creation andgovernance of security strategy, standards, frameworks, and policies.
- Identify and communicatesecurity risks in a timely manner while incorporating insights from privacy,legal, engineering, and operational stakeholders.
- Develop strategic relationshipsacross industry and technology vendors to anticipate emerging threats andopportunities.
- Mentor and coach risk assessorsand secondees through guidance, feedback, and knowledge sharing.
- Manage complex initiativeswhile simplifying outcomes to support effective delivery and execution.

Qualificationsand Experience

- Minimum 15 years of experiencewithin Cyber Security.
- At least 8 years of experiencein a Governance, Risk and Compliance (GRC) or Risk Management function.
- Practical experience conductingtechnical risk assessments.
- Knowledge of industryframeworks and standards including ISO 27001, PCI-DSS, NIST, and enterprisesecurity frameworks.
- Solid stakeholder engagementand communication skills with the ability to translate technical risks intobusiness insights.
- Experience working within largeand complex enterprise environments.
- Previous experience in anon-cyber risk or GRC role.
- Industry certifications such asCRISC, CISSP, CISM, or SABSA.
- Experience working within Agileand DevOps environments.
